Tutumlu claims another podium in International GT Open

Isaac Tutumlu will remember for years to come the second race of the International GT Open at the Autódromo do Algarve. It was a race even more difficult than that celebrated on Saturday. In race one, despite a huge time handicap – 85 seconds-, Tutumlu and his teammate Maxime Soulet claimed an impressive race win. But the challenge on Sunday with 100 seconds made it even more exacting.

Soulet, driving the Chevrolet Corvette C6/ZR1 entered by Selleslagh Racing Team by Barzani, started from the pole position and led for his entire stint. By the halfway point Soulet pitted and Tutumlu took over at the wheel of the American muscle car. His race pace was absolutely amazing and caught and passed Sdanewitsch before long. But his next stop was Montermini, and Tutumlu and his Italian rival started an unforgettable duel. Finally, after some excellent maneuvers, Tutumlu overtook Montermini´s Ferrari. With Maleev ahead, Tutumlu picked up his slipstream but the Russian spun and Tutumlu ran wide to avoid an accident. Montermini took advantage from this to overtake Tutumlu again and the Barzani Racing Team could not retake that place. Anyway, when the race was over, another car was disqualified by reason of running under weight and Tutumlu and Soulet moved into podium places.

“Brilliant weekend for us as we achieved first and third places two pole positions and fastest laps. I am delighted to drive this car, I feel so comfortable at the wheel and I want to thank SRT by Barzani and Corvette Racing their support along the whole weekend. Of course I will not forget about my teammate Maxime and my sponsors, Barzani family, Ster Group and Golden Eagle Global”, Tutumlu commented, highlighting “my battle with Montermini was incredible, his experience is huge and I fought against him for several laps. We were the quickest this weekend and our goal is to follow the same path within two weeks. We really strive!”.
